Best Robotic Mop and Vacuum Combos
The majority of robot vacuum and mop combinations can be customized with an application that is specifically designed for. You can save maps of your house as well as set up cleaning schedules and select the mopping mode you prefer. You can also alter the suction power, as well as the amount of water the mop is using.
A mapping feature helps your robot navigate rooms and obstacles, while an obstacle avoidance function will stop it from hitting wires, furniture, or even stray pet toys. These are essential features for my home, which is filled with strewn-about toys.
1. Roborock S8 Pro Ultra
Roborock S8 Pro Ultra, the top-of-the-line vacuum and mop, comes packed with features. It's able to both mop and sweep in one session and can raise its brushes and mop pads to prevent soft surfaces from becoming damp. It can also stay clear of obstacles by finding pets, plants, and other small objects.
The robotic vacuum has a suction power of 6,000 pascals which is higher than any other robot vacuum cleaner reviews automatic vacuum and mop robot we've tested to date. It also has PreciSense LiDAR Navigation, which tracks its position, which prevents it from becoming stuck on objects.
The mopping function is impressive and Best Robotic Mop and Vacuum the S8 Pro Ultra able to apply constant pressure of over 6 Newtons to the mop pad, resulting in deep cleaning. It also comes with mop lifter technology that will lift the pad automatically when it is able to switch between tile, laminate or hardwood flooring, as well as carpet or rugs to prevent soaking soft surfaces.
The S8 Pro Ultra also has self-washing and self drying features. The pad can be cleaned and heat-dried within the dock, and the dust bin will get emptied and automatically returned to it. You can set it and forget about it. You will only need to replenish the water tank or change the dust bag every now and then.
All of this is powered by a 5,200mAh lithium-ion battery. I tested it with its normal mop and vac settings for approximately 160 minutes before the S8 Pro Ultra started to be power-deficient and then return to its base to recharge. This isn't too far off of the 180-minute time that Roborock claims and is in line with other hybrids that I've tried.
It's a complete and robust product, with its only downsides being the fact that it's expensive. But its abundance of features makes it a appealing choice for anyone looking to ditch their old stick vacuums and mops. If you can afford the hefty price tag we recommend you check this one out.
2. Dreametech L10S Ultra
The Dreametech L10S Ultra is a premium robot vacuum and mop combo. Its price is justified by its powerful features, which include the capacity to vacuum large volumes and two gyrating mop mops. It also includes an app-based, smart controller and powerful obstacle avoidance technology.
The L10S Ultra has a retail price of 999 Euros, which is among the highest robotic vacuum and mop combinations available. In my tests, it performed well across all areas of the home, removing 98.4 percent of the debris on all types of floors and able to lift long hair without tangling. The mops also performed admirably and produced excellent results for cleaning with less effort than many mid-range models. This was due to their rotational motion and the powerful cleaning solution.
The L10S Ultra's most significant selling point is its innovative multifunctional docking station. The dock emptys its dustbin into dirt bag, fills its water tank for mopping, and dry its mop pads for you. It is equipped with a real-time danger detection system, and its smart controls let you schedule periodic cleaning sessions.
The L10S Ultra does not offer the best automatic vacuum cleaner performance in removing carpet debris when compared to the other hybrid mop I tested. In addition, its mops aren't as capable at scrubbing away stubborn stains as those found in the Roborock S7 MaxV Ultra, which is the most expensive model. Roborock S7 MaxV Ultra.
Despite the L10S Ultra's high-end features, it still requires regular care and maintenance. The base station must be cleaned out as well as the water tank and dust bag should be cleaned, emptied and dried regularly to prevent mildew and unpleasant odors. It is also important to keep in mind that the mop pads, which are purchased separately, must be replaced regularly too.
With the L10S Ultra's pricey pricing and its extensive features I would highly recommend it to anyone with the funds for it. For those who are on a tighter budget, I suggest considering a less basic model that will allow you to save money while still enjoying the convenience of hands-free cleaning at home. Even it were the case that the L10S Ultra was the best robotic mop and vacuum combination you could purchase, its high cost and frequent maintenance will make it seem more an item to have than one that you actually need.
3. Eufy S1 Pro
If you're looking for a robot mop and vacuum that will pick up dirt and dust on your hard floors, while taking care of wet messes take a look at the Eufy S1 Pro. This powerful robovac/mop combination has a powerful suction capacity of 8,000 Pa. It also has a huge battery capacity that can be used for both mopping and vacuuming. It is also equipped with a top-quality obstacle-avoidance technology. It also comes with a roller mop that cleans itself while moving and makes the S1 Pro stand out from other models that need to return to their base station mid-cleaning to wash off the mop's pad.
The S1 Pro uses a unique mopping system that is a major contrast to the microfiber pads and spinning discs of other robots. The roller covers the entire width of the robot, and it gets a constant supply of fresh, ozonated filtered water from the dock. As it rotates the roller, it scrubs your floors while soaking up dirt, and any dry debris is picked up by the side brushes or swept away into the front colision bumper. The S1 Pro removes the dirty mop water into its base station, where it is sucked by the tank's heater elements and it is emptied into a bigger storage container. The tank onboard can hold a substantial amount of water and take on up to a dozen mopping sessions before rushing out.
Like most robotic vacuums and mop sets, the S1 Pro is ready to come out of the box. The S1 Pro needs to be filled with clean water. This is easily done in the cleaning dock. If you'd like to make use of your own cleaner you can include a cleaning solution to dock. If you decide to select this option, you'll need to purchase the branded cleaning solution from Eufy which is more expensive than other robot brands that allow users to use their own cleaner of choice.
The S1 Pro performed well in the coverage and efficiency of navigation tests, as did most robots that vacuum and mop. It was quick to map a room and it was able to navigate through furniture. It was stuck on carpets with longer piles a few times during my tests. However, this could be improved by re-updating the software. The S1 Pro is an all-in-one robot that has lots of features at an affordable price.
4. Roborock Qrevo
The Qrevo is Roborock's entry-level mop and vacuum. However, it still offers some impressive features. The dock's multifunction emptying the robot's dirtbag and refilling its water tanks, and cleaning and sanitizing the mop pads is handled by the dock. The mopping system itself is capable cleaning a good bit of an area before it needs to return to its dock and the vacuum's high suction is capable of picking up debris and pet hair from carpets.
The app that runs the appliance is quite complex, with a broad variety of options to personalize the cleaning process. You can clean manually all areas mapped by this device or choose individual rooms, an expandable zone or a routine you've created. SmartPlan is one of the mopping options. It uses the sensors on the mops to map out the space and determine the most efficient way to clean it.
Like the other Roborock models we've examined, the Qrevo performs well in our tests. Its navigation system works well, mapping rooms quickly and cleaning in a neat manner. Its 'Normal" pathing option covers a room well, without any major gaps or missed areas. Reactive Tech's hazard avoidance works well, but it's not as advanced as the color camera systems found on the Qrevo Master and the S8 Pro Ultra. It can detect dangers such as carpets with thick padding, but might not be able to identify smaller objects like electrical wires or rug tassels.
This machine has one major problem: it doesn't have a mop option after vacuuming. This could be a problem for those who vacuum a lot before using their robot. Fortunately, there's a simple alternative: the app has an option to "clean up" at the end of each vacuuming session. This lets you use the mopping function of the vacuum to eliminate the last traces of dust and debris that you've left behind from the vacuuming. This is a nice feature that can help this robot to clean up a bit better than its less expensive competitors.
